Project: Feasibility study, including elaboration of pre-design for reconstruction of the following systems of the Center for Mother and Child in Chisinau

In order to support further development of the energy sector, the GoM has received from the Sida a Grant (the Grant) to finance the Moldova Energy Programme, and it intends to apply part of the proceeds of this Grant for payments under the contract for consulting services covering elaboration of a feasibility study, including pre-design for reconstruction of the systems of the Center for Mother and Child (CMC) in Chisinau.

The objective of this assignment is covering elaboration of a feasibility study, including pre-design for reconstruction of the following systems of the CMC:

- external district heating distribution systems,
- external cold water and sewerage systems,
- internal domestic cold and hot water systems, internal sewerage systems,
- individual district heating substations for connection of the internal heating systems and domestic hot water preparation,
- internal heating systems,
- internal ventilation systems.

GENERAL PROCUREMENT NOTICE

Country: Moldova
Project: Moldova Energy II Project Additional Financing
Financing: International Development Association (IDA)
Sector: Energy
Project ID: P113569

The Republic of Moldova has applied for a credit from the International Development Association (IDA) in the amount of US$ 10 million equivalent toward the cost of the Energy II Project Additional Financing, and it intends to apply the proceeds of this credit to payments for goods and related services to be procured under this project.

The objectives for the Moldova Energy II Project Additional Financing are to: improve the availability, quality, and efficiency of heating and hot water supply in selected priority public buildings (schools, hospitals, and residential buildings for disabled and other vulnerable groups).
The Project consists of the following components:

 
• Assistance for the Project Implementation, Heating Component (continuation of ongoing technical assistance financed by Sida);
• Heating Supply and Efficiency Improvement: this component includes improvements in supply and distribution of heat and demand side measures for heat and hot water consumption in selected public buildings (schools, hospitals, and residential buildings for disabled and other vulnerable groups);
• Project Management and Administration.

Financing: The project will be financed by an IDA credit in the amount of US$ 10 million equivalent. Sweden is providing a technical assistance grant for the heating component.

Procurement of contracts financed by the credit will be conducted through the procedures specified in the World Bank's Guidelines: Procurement under IBRD Loans and IDA Credits and is open to all bidders from eligible source countries as defined in the guidelines. Consulting services will be selected by Sida.
